Women�s Football League goes into recess

 

Many had written them out after their slow start to the season. Township Rollers are second on the league table with 20 points from seven games. With two games in hand, Rollers look set to give the defending champions a run for their money when the league continues in February next year.

Prisons XI are sitting at position three with 19 points from nine games while The Meat Girls from Lobatse occupy position four with 17 points. They have played seven games just like Rollers. Other League giants, UB Kicks are sitting in position eight. They have collected 11 points from seven games played, while Vico Mates are languishing at the bottom of the log standings. They have accumulated just one point from nine games.

This league is yet to find a sponsor following the end of a contract between the league and AT&T Monnakgotla. UB Kicks team manager, Phenyo Gabolekane said even without a sponsor, the league has been competitive and entertaining this season. “We might have no sponsor, but our teams are taking this league seriously. There are no easy games,” he said.
